Output 70d16f8bec83a9986013457f0de0ac7faccb9fcfaee9192cc2a4a607ff18ac27:0

value
97900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06fd8ff6747aa9bc39fe14f06085fa2b9fb0e198 OP_EQUAL
address
32KyjWt1Afdkqo4HFi3MStfTQfuzR5YHyy
transaction
70d16f8bec83a9986013457f0de0ac7faccb9fcfaee9192cc2a4a607ff18ac27
confirmations
57055
spent
true